Keeping Organized

I use the software called Scrivener. It helps me keep my posts organized in a way that makes sense for me. I don’t have to worry about creating all kinds of file folders to hold all kinds of Word documents as I create my various stories. Some of my most loyal followers have seen snapshots of it on social media.
The software lets me work out of one single file and in it is a “file tree” that lets me see the various posts that I’m working on. Just click on the one to work on, and voila, I’m working on the next post. (Thinking of linking another author’s wonderful explanation with visual effects…)
